Output 128f1df90f322308d698825c1497f48505c0a07ff7b10fbbe21d723b47c0b7e5:0

value
11605971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ab8aa0462a8a36adf2b452f18fe44cda069341 OP_EQUAL
address
3QBHeeUfahWo8LUTBtWZL9KpVdbheF65Jp
transaction
128f1df90f322308d698825c1497f48505c0a07ff7b10fbbe21d723b47c0b7e5
spent
true